Lymphocyte dysfunction caused by deficiencies in purine metabolism
D A Carson1, E Lakow, D B Wasson
1Department of Clinical Research, Scripps Clinic and Research Foundation, La Jolla, CA 92037, U.S.A.
Abstract:
Two inborn errors of purine metabolism have been associated with autosomally inherited human immunodeficiency diseases. A lack of adenosine deaminase (ADA) produces severe lymphopenia and a combined immunodeficiency syndrome. A deficiency of purine nucleoside phosphorylase (PNP) is associated with a selective cellular immune depth. This article discusses the probable biochemical basis for lymphocyte-specific toxicity in these disorders.
